1. Cardioid
Cardioid
microphones are probably one of the first terms you will come across
when you have to buy microphones. This is because of their unique shape
and the functions related to the microphones. With a heart- like the
shape of the mic, these devices are designed in a manner which makes
them ideal for recording music and singing.
2. Omni-directional
Another
term which you should be familiar with is the omni-directional
microphones. As the name suggests, these mics are used for recording
sounds from all directions. This makes them suited for situations where
you do not need to focus on a particular sound. For instance, you can
use an omni-directional mic for the purposes of reporting.
4. Variable directional
You
will need to know about variable directional when you are looking for a
microphone which can provide you with different sound frequencies.
Microphones which have variable directional frequencies can enable you
to switch between different directions of the sound. This means that you
have the option to record the sound in the way you want.
